California’s 2020 Minimum Wage Increase to Affect Exempt and Nonexempt Employees
A new year means new changes to California’s minimum wage laws. California employers should take note of the following changes to state and local minimum wage laws, set to take effect on January 1, 2020, and will impact both nonexempt and exempt...
